BANANA WALNUT LOAF
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Next, prepare a loaf pan by lining the sides with parchment paper. Alternatively, if using a loaf pan with a design, like the one in the photos, generously coat the inside of the loaf pan with non-stick cooking spray. Set aside.
- In a large mixing bowl, use a spatula to mix together all of the ingredients except the walnuts. There is no need for mixing the wet ingredients first or sifting the dry ingredients together. (I told you this was easy!)
- Once a batter has formed, add the walnut pieces and fold into the batter.
- Spoon the batter into the prepared loaf pan. Tap the filled loaf pan 3 or 4 times on the counter top to remove air bubbles and to ensure the thick batter has settled into the loaf pan's corners.
- Bake for 45-50 minutes. Test for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the middle of the loaf. If the toothpick comes out clean, the loaf is done, if not, place the loaf back in the oven for an additional 5 minutes.
- Cool completely on a cooling rack before slicing.

BANANA & WALNUT LOAF
This homely and wholesome cake is also light and moist, with the natural sweetness of sticky bananas and the warm toastiness of nuts
Provided by Gregg Wallace
Categories Afternoon tea, Dessert, Treat
Time 1h15m
Yield Cuts into 8 slices
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Grease a 2lb loaf tin with some butter and line the base with baking parchment, then grease this as well.
- In a large bowl, mix together the butter, sugar and egg, then slowly mix in flour and baking powder. Peel, then mash the bananas. Now mix everything together, including the nuts.
- Pour your mixture into the tin and bake for 1 hr, or until a skewer comes out clean. Allow the cake to cool on a wire rack before removing from the loaf tin. The loaf can now be wrapped tightly in cling film and kept for up to 2 days, or frozen for up to 1 month. Defrost and warm through before serving. Serve in thick slices topped with vanilla ice cream and drizzled with a little Easy chocolate sauce (see recipe, below).

BANANA-WALNUT LOAF
You can toast slices of this all-purpose loaf for breakfast, serve it for tea in the afternoon, or top a piece with vanilla ice cream for dessert.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Breakfast & Brunch Recipes Bread Recipes
Time 1h30m
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Butter a 9-by-5-by-3-inch (2-quart) loaf pan; set aside.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, salt, and baking soda; set aside.
- In the bowl of an electric mixer,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Add e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. With mixer on low speed, add flour mixture in three additions, alternating with two additions of banana; mix until just combined. Stir in walnuts, if desired, by hand.
- Pour batter into prepared pan. Bake until a toothpick inserted in center comes out with only a few moist crumbs attached, 60 to 70 minutes. Let cool 10 minutes in pan, then turn out of pan and let cool completely on a wire rack.

EASY BANANA WALNUT LOAF
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 F. Thoroughly grease a 9-inch loaf pan.
- Combine fl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, 5-spice powder and walnuts.
- Mash the bananas. Stir in the melted butter.
- Beat the eggs. Add sugar and continue to beat till dissolved. Stir in vanilla. Add mixture to the bananas.
- Fold the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ients till combined and all the flour is mixed. Do not over-mix the flour as it will result in a tough bread. A lumpy batter is alright.
- Pour the batter into a greased 9" loaf pan. Bake at 350F for 45-50 min or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Allow to cool on a wire rack. Best eaten warm and with milk.

BANANA WALNUT BREAD
Walnuts star in this easy-to-make Banana Walnut Bread recipe from Food Network Kitchen. Slice it up and serve with coffee or tea.
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Time 1h20m
Yield 1 loaf
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Sift the flour, baking soda, and salt into a medium bowl, set aside. Whisk the eggs and vanilla together in a liquid measuring cup with a spout, set aside. Lightly brush a 9 by 5 by 3-inch loaf pan with butter.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- In a standing mixer fitted with the paddle attachment or with an electric hand-held mixer, cream the but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Gradually pour the egg mixture into the butter while mixing until incorporated. Add the bananas (the mixture will appear to be curdled, so don't worry), and remove the bowl from the mixer.
- With a rubber spatula, mix in the flour mixture until just incorporated. Fold in the nuts and transfer the batter to the prepared pan. Bake for 55 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the bread comes out clean. Cool the bread in the pan on a wire rack for 5 minutes. Turn the bread out of the pan and let cool completely on the rack. Wrap in plastic wrap. The banana bread is best if served the next day.
EASY BANANA CAKE RECIPE
Easy Banana Cake - this fluffy and moist sheet cake is has a light mascarpone frosting on top and it ready in under 30 minutes! A perfect cake to use all those overripe bananas.
Provided by Julia Foerster
Categories Dessert
Time 30m
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C). Grease a 9x13-inch baking pan. Set aside.
- In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, cream butter and sugar together at medium-high speed until light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add eggs, mashed bananas, buttermilk, and vanilla extract. Mix at low speed until combined.
- In a small bowl combine flour, baking soda, and salt.
- Add flour mixture in three additions to the wet mixture, mix just until combined.
- Pour batter into the baking dish and bake for 20-25 minutes. When the cake is done a skewer inserted in the middle should come out clean with only a few crumbs attached. Let the cake cool down completely before frosting it.
- To make the frosting, beat together butter and confectioners' sugar in the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ment until light and fluffy.
- Add vanilla extract and mascarpone and beat until blended. Frost cooled cake.
